"I graduated with my PhD in Chemistry from University of California San Diego in 2020. My research was in the area of cell signaling. More specifically I synthesized a series of compounds and then I tested the ability of these compounds to inhibit a pro-inflammatory pathway in cells. Though I had always enjoyed math and science, my earlier collegiate studies were concentrated in the humanities. I studied history as an undergraduate at the University of New Orleans. I earned a post-graduate degree in British and EU law while studying abroad in London, UK. While I have experience tutoring across a wide spectrum of topics, my most recent teaching experience has been in general chemistry, organic chemistry, and biochemistry.

As a graduate student, I taught organic chemistry laboratory for seven terms. I prepared brief laboratory lectures, wrote laboratory quizzes, and monitored student experiments. As a teaching assistant at UCSD, I hosted organic chemistry study sessions for groups and for individuals. As a researcher I have mentored several undergraduate students in chemistry. Before becoming a graduate student I tutored groups of students in general chemistry on a weekly basis. I have tutored students my whole life starting in elementary school and continuing through to the present. In addition to chemistry, I have helped students improve their writing, their math skills, and their reading skills.

As a post-doctoral researcher, I completed a course focused on the Three-Dimensional Learning Assessment Protocol. While I have always used modeling and crosscutting concepts to encourage student understanding rather than memorization, this course made me aware of additional resources for crafting questions and examples that promote active student engagement.

I love meeting students wherever they are in their learning journey and providing the support that will help them build confidence and achieve their learning goals." less...
